For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 1,202 students in Westborough, MA. The top-ranked public high school in Westborough, MA is Westborough High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Westborough, MA public high school have an average math proficiency score of 87% (versus the Massachusetts public high school average of 45%), and reading proficiency score of 85% (versus the 52% statewide average). High schools in Westborough have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 5% of Massachusetts public high schools.
Westborough, MA public high school have a Graduation Rate of 96%, which is more than the Massachusetts average of 90%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Westborough High School, with 96%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Massachusetts or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 48% of the student body (majority Asian), which is equal to the Massachusetts public high school average of 48% (majority Hispanic).
